Renewable energy sources have gained increasing importance as the world looks to transition to cleaner, more sustainable forms of energy generation. Numerical methods play a key role in optimizing the efficiency and effectiveness of renewable energy systems. In this blog post, we will explore how numerical methods are used in the design, analysis, and optimization of renewable energy systems.

One common application of Numerical methods in renewable energy is in the modeling and simulation of renewable energy systems. This includes the use of computational fluid dynamics (CFD) to model the airflow around wind turbines and solar panels, as well as finite element analysis (FEA) to analyze the structural integrity of renewable energy infrastructure. By using numerical methods to simulate different scenarios and conditions, engineers can better understand how renewable energy systems will perform in real-world conditions and make informed design decisions. Numerical methods are also used in the optimization of renewable energy systems to maximize energy production and efficiency. For example, algorithms such as genetic algorithms and simulated annealing can be used to optimize the placement of wind turbines in a wind farm to take advantage of prevailing wind patterns. Similarly, numerical methods can be used to optimize the design of solar panel arrays to maximize solar exposure and energy capture. Additionally, numerical methods are used in renewable energy forecasting to predict energy production from renewable sources such as wind and solar power. By analyzing historical weather data and using numerical weather prediction models, researchers can forecast future energy production from renewable sources with a high degree of accuracy. These forecasts are essential for energy grid operators to efficiently integrate renewable energy into the grid and ensure a stable and reliable energy supply. In conclusion, numerical methods play a critical role in the design, analysis, and optimization of renewable energy systems. By using advanced computational techniques, engineers and researchers can improve the efficiency, reliability, and cost-effectiveness of renewable energy generation. As the world continues to transition to a more sustainable energy future, numerical methods will be indispensable in driving innovation and technological advancements in the field of renewable energy.
